St Etienne are considering a move for Milan midfielder
Johann Vogel as the French club continue plans for strengthening their squad.Having sold Didier Zokora to Tottenham Hotspur last week, St Etienne
have money to spend and a midfield to reinforce.
Among the club's purported targets is Switzerland international
Vogel, who featured for his country at the World Cup.
Vogel's club future is unclear due to Milan being under investigation in
Italy as part of a match-fixing scandal.
Even if Milan avoid any punishment, Vogel could be on the move
after a mixed debut season in Serie A following his switch from PSV Eindhoven.
Les Verts also have several other avenues to explore, with the
Ligue 1 side keen to buttress most areas of the squad.
Paris Saint Germain full back Stephane Pichot, Boca Juniors' Jose Maria Calvo
and Messina's Ivory Coast international Marco Zoro are in the frame.
Up front, St Etienne maintain an interest in Marseille forward
Peguy Luyindula, along with Portsmouth's Benjani Mwaruwari,
Sochaux's Ilan and Besiktas' Tomas Jun.
